SimulIDE бесплатный симулятор электроники (PIC, AVR, цифра)
Moderator: Shaos
-
- Junior
- Posts: 3
- Joined: 15 Nov 2023 14:52
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Только скачал программу. Решил попробовать после того как увидел демонстрацию работы
https://youtu.be/xvSK6eoMHIw?si=1Lqb_iBGhaZg8PAT
Вывод звука на динамики в реальном времени ни где раньше не видел.
В чат отправил картинку с багом в интерфейсе как мне показалось.
Еще из интересного, хелп на русском лучше, чем на английском (там его вообще нет по тем компонентам что смотрел)
https://youtu.be/xvSK6eoMHIw?si=1Lqb_iBGhaZg8PAT
Вывод звука на динамики в реальном времени ни где раньше не видел.
В чат отправил картинку с багом в интерфейсе как мне показалось.
Еще из интересного, хелп на русском лучше, чем на английском (там его вообще нет по тем компонентам что смотрел)
Last edited by sim31r on 18 Nov 2023 14:52, edited 1 time in total.
-
- Junior
- Posts: 3
- Joined: 15 Nov 2023 14:52
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
В новой версии глюк с MOSFET ушел, он работал как ключевой элемент похоже и сбивал симулятор в припадок какой-то. Если имитировать полевой биполярным с высоким входным сопротивлением работало нормально.
В R1909 как на картинке. После кратковременного нажатия на кнопку припадок прекращался.
В R2048 всё ok. Ошибку не смог повторить, даже при самом грубом шаге моделирования.
В R1909 как на картинке. После кратковременного нажатия на кнопку припадок прекращался.
В R2048 всё ok. Ошибку не смог повторить, даже при самом грубом шаге моделирования.
You do not have the required permissions to view the files attached to this post.
-
- Maniac
- Posts: 251
- Joined: 11 Oct 2018 00:52
- Location: г. Клинцы, Брянская обл.
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Если я правильно понял суть проблемы, то решение такое: в свойствах любого переменного компонента нужно отметить необходимый параметр. В данном случае это будет "Current Value"sim31r wrote:Что-то с резистором переменным не то в интерфейсе
You do not have the required permissions to view the files attached to this post.
-
- Junior
- Posts: 3
- Joined: 15 Nov 2023 14:52
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Да пока премодерация была уже разобрались. По первой части в новом обновлении build 2048 решили, стало работать стабильнее. Наверное модель полевого транзистора поправили, до этого мультивибратор на ПТ или параметрический стабилизатор на ПТ заклинивало просто. На биполярном транзисторе кстати работало идеально. Помню что в других симуляторах проблема с мультивибратором присутствовала и проверил тут. Сейчас можно на некоторых шагах интервала симуляции добиться некорректной работы, но в целом нормально.
По второму вопросу на сайте разработчика уже ответ был. Теперь понял в каком стиле идет визуализация, вполне логично всё.
По второму вопросу на сайте разработчика уже ответ был. Теперь понял в каком стиле идет визуализация, вполне логично всё.
-
- Maniac
- Posts: 251
- Joined: 11 Oct 2018 00:52
- Location: г. Клинцы, Брянская обл.
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Хелп я "сочинял" весь полностью (на русском). Т.е. перевел английскую версию и дополнил его изменениями на момент перевода. Он в настоящее время очень сильно устарел. Например: осциллограф описывается одноканальный. В программе он эволюционировал до 2-х канального, потом и до 4-х канального (было несколько версий). Многие примитивы вообще не отхелплены.sim31r wrote:Еще из интересного, хелп на русском лучше, чем на английском (там его вообще нет по тем компонентам что смотрел)
Вообще я планирую доработать хелп до актуального состояния и сделать описание каждой микросхемы. Это адский труд (микросхем более 300 штук). Время нужно найти...
-
- Maniac
- Posts: 251
- Joined: 11 Oct 2018 00:52
- Location: г. Клинцы, Брянская обл.
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Вышла новая тестовая сборка программы SimulIDE-R2056
Скачать можно здесь: https://simulide.forumotion.com/t550-si ... ter-builds
Эта версия содержит ошибку в компоненте "controlled source", из-за которой не работают подсхемы LM3914-LM3916, TL494.
Скачивать программу имеет смысл только для поиска ошибок.
Изменения в программе:
Bug Fixes:
- Diode: Error in linked value.
- Controlled Source: Current is reversed.
- Debugger: path error in Windows.
- SDCC for PIC: search variables.
- Memory: missing some events.
Changes:
- Micro sensors & peripherals are graphical.
- Subcircuits: make Boards visible inside other boards.
Скачать можно здесь: https://simulide.forumotion.com/t550-si ... ter-builds
Эта версия содержит ошибку в компоненте "controlled source", из-за которой не работают подсхемы LM3914-LM3916, TL494.
Скачивать программу имеет смысл только для поиска ошибок.
Изменения в программе:
Bug Fixes:
- Diode: Error in linked value.
- Controlled Source: Current is reversed.
- Debugger: path error in Windows.
- SDCC for PIC: search variables.
- Memory: missing some events.
Changes:
- Micro sensors & peripherals are graphical.
- Subcircuits: make Boards visible inside other boards.
-
- Maniac
- Posts: 251
- Joined: 11 Oct 2018 00:52
- Location: г. Клинцы, Брянская обл.
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Автор программы сообщил, что открыл новый сайт и новый форум: https://simulide.forumotion.com/t1931-new-web-site
Старый форум будет доступен по старым ссылкам только для чтения (некоторое время постить еще можно).
Новый сайт находится по адресу: https://simulide.com/p/
Через поисковую систему также попадаем на новый сайт.
Старый форум будет доступен по старым ссылкам только для чтения (некоторое время постить еще можно).
Новый сайт находится по адресу: https://simulide.com/p/
Через поисковую систему также попадаем на новый сайт.
-
- Maniac
- Posts: 251
- Joined: 11 Oct 2018 00:52
- Location: г. Клинцы, Брянская обл.
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
После выхода релиза SimulIDE-R2056 обнаружилось, что подсхемы TL494, LM3914-LM3916 перестали работать.
Во вложении исправленные версии.
Внимание!
Некоторые схемы, содержащие компонент "Controlled Source" в новой версии могут не работать. Для восстановления работоспособности схемы необходимо в его свойствах у параметра Gain поменять знак на противоположный!
Во вложении исправленные версии.
Внимание!
Некоторые схемы, содержащие компонент "Controlled Source" в новой версии могут не работать. Для восстановления работоспособности схемы необходимо в его свойствах у параметра Gain поменять знак на противоположный!
You do not have the required permissions to view the files attached to this post.
-
- Maniac
- Posts: 251
- Joined: 11 Oct 2018 00:52
- Location: г. Клинцы, Брянская обл.
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
По мере развития программы, в ней появляются новые компоненты.
Рассмотрим назначение и настройки компонента "Управляемый источник" ("Controlled Source").
Это универсальный управляемый источник тока или напряжения - все зависит от настроек компонента. Подобные источники часто применяются при создании моделей микросхем во многих симуляторах.
Например, я давно хотел сделать модель микросхемы TL494 для SimulIDE. У меня возникла проблема с моделированием генератора пилообразного напряжения. Перепробовав несколько вариантов я не достиг желаемого результата. Обратился к автору программы с просьбой создать модели источника тока и источника напряжения, которые можно добавлять в подсхемы. Автор сообщил, что уже некоторое время работает над созданием универсального источника.
Через некоторое время он появился в сборке SimulIDE v1.1.0 и я смог закончить модель TL494.

На рисунке часть схемы модели TL494. Рассматриваемые источники обведены красной рамкой.
Рассмотрим настройки этого компонента.
Сам компонент находится в группе "Источники" ("Sources"). Выносим его на рабочее поле и открываем настройки.

Чекбоксы:
1. Источник тока. Если отмечен, то мы имеем источник тока, если не отмечен, то имеем источник напряжения.
2. Управление током. В случае управляемого источника выбираем способ управления. Ели отмечен, то управляем током, если не отмечен - управляем напряжением.
3. Управляющие контакты. Если отмечен, то на компоненте отображаются контакты для подключения управляющего напряжения (тока). В этом случае мы имеем управляемый источник. Если не отмечен, то мы получаем источник постоянного напряжения (тока).
Примеры.
Неуправляемый источник напряжения и тока. Можно указать необходимое напряжение или ток:

Источник тока, управляемый напряжением и током. Параметр "Усиление" задает связь между управляющей величиной и управляемой:

Источник напряжения, управляемый напряжением и током:

Надеюсь, информация будет полезной.
Рассмотрим назначение и настройки компонента "Управляемый источник" ("Controlled Source").
Это универсальный управляемый источник тока или напряжения - все зависит от настроек компонента. Подобные источники часто применяются при создании моделей микросхем во многих симуляторах.
Например, я давно хотел сделать модель микросхемы TL494 для SimulIDE. У меня возникла проблема с моделированием генератора пилообразного напряжения. Перепробовав несколько вариантов я не достиг желаемого результата. Обратился к автору программы с просьбой создать модели источника тока и источника напряжения, которые можно добавлять в подсхемы. Автор сообщил, что уже некоторое время работает над созданием универсального источника.
Через некоторое время он появился в сборке SimulIDE v1.1.0 и я смог закончить модель TL494.

На рисунке часть схемы модели TL494. Рассматриваемые источники обведены красной рамкой.
Рассмотрим настройки этого компонента.
Сам компонент находится в группе "Источники" ("Sources"). Выносим его на рабочее поле и открываем настройки.

Чекбоксы:
1. Источник тока. Если отмечен, то мы имеем источник тока, если не отмечен, то имеем источник напряжения.
2. Управление током. В случае управляемого источника выбираем способ управления. Ели отмечен, то управляем током, если не отмечен - управляем напряжением.
3. Управляющие контакты. Если отмечен, то на компоненте отображаются контакты для подключения управляющего напряжения (тока). В этом случае мы имеем управляемый источник. Если не отмечен, то мы получаем источник постоянного напряжения (тока).
Примеры.
Неуправляемый источник напряжения и тока. Можно указать необходимое напряжение или ток:

Источник тока, управляемый напряжением и током. Параметр "Усиление" задает связь между управляющей величиной и управляемой:

Источник напряжения, управляемый напряжением и током:

Надеюсь, информация будет полезной.
-
- Admin
- Posts: 23763
- Joined: 08 Jan 2003 23:22
- Location: Silicon Valley
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
А напряжение всё ещё нельзя в минус выкручивать?
Я тут за главного - если что шлите мыло на me собака shaos точка net
-
- Maniac
- Posts: 251
- Joined: 11 Oct 2018 00:52
- Location: г. Клинцы, Брянская обл.
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Если я правильно понял суть вопроса, то можно.Shaos wrote:А напряжение всё ещё нельзя в минус выкручивать?
You do not have the required permissions to view the files attached to this post.
-
- Admin
- Posts: 23763
- Joined: 08 Jan 2003 23:22
- Location: Silicon Valley
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Только через делитель напряжения на переменном резисторе?
А управляемым источником напряжения никак?
Типа вот так:
А управляемым источником напряжения никак?
Типа вот так:
You do not have the required permissions to view the files attached to this post.
Я тут за главного - если что шлите мыло на me собака shaos точка net
-
- Maniac
- Posts: 251
- Joined: 11 Oct 2018 00:52
- Location: г. Клинцы, Брянская обл.
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Понял.
Подобный источник можно сделать самостоятельно в виде подсхемы. Только не очень удобно будет задавать максимальное напряжение.
Идея отличная. Попробую предложить на основном форуме. Думаю, автор доработает источник тока и напряжения в ближайшее время.
Подобный источник можно сделать самостоятельно в виде подсхемы. Только не очень удобно будет задавать максимальное напряжение.
Идея отличная. Попробую предложить на основном форуме. Думаю, автор доработает источник тока и напряжения в ближайшее время.
-
- Admin
- Posts: 23763
- Joined: 08 Jan 2003 23:22
- Location: Silicon Valley
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Ну там по идее просто галочку добавить в опциях - типа чекбокс для двуполярного источника питания и максимум превращается в плюс-минус максимум и минимум - что-то типа такого...
Я тут за главного - если что шлите мыло на me собака shaos точка net
-
- Maniac
- Posts: 251
- Joined: 11 Oct 2018 00:52
- Location: г. Клинцы, Брянская обл.
Re: SimulIDE бесплатный симулятор электроники (PIC, AVR, циф
Автор сделал доработку....
Ждем новой сборки.
Ждем новой сборки.
You do not have the required permissions to view the files attached to this post.